I would recommend ringing your midwife to be safe. I had this during pregnancy a couple of times. Turned out to be cervical ectropian, which many women experience due to hormonal changes. I did not affect my pregnancy in any way but they always checked me out. And because I was rhesus negative blood type I needed anti-D injection. That’s why I think it would be worth calling midwife
